Georgia has much to offer outdoor enthusiast. Climb, hike and mountain bike through Georgia, or enjoy a relaxing day fishing or picnicking near tranquil lakes and rivers. The Vashlovani Protected Area, Javakheti plateau, and Kolkheti National Park provide unmatched possibilities for birdwatchers to observe some of the region's most uncommon species. The bright lakes of Abudelauri are one of Georgia's most aesthetically stunning natural attractions. This is also a fantastic trekking destination, so if you're visiting Georgia in the summer, add this untamed bit of beauty to your itinerary. The Imereti region of Georgia is noted for its lush flora, stunning limestone cliffs, and plenty of water—rivers, streams, and lakes.
